Industry Policy Committee Survey on the problems of healthcare professionals in rare diseases

Patients and their families with rare diseases face a variety of challenges from the onset of the disease, through testing/confirmed diagnosis, to the start of treatment. In order to understand the background and factors behind these challenges, the Pharmaceutical Manufacturers Association of Japan (PMAJ) conducted the "Survey on Challenges Facing Patients with Rare Diseases (released in February 2023)" and identified particularly important issues that pharmaceutical companies should address. In response to these issues, we compiled the "Proposal on Intractable and Rare Diseases (released in July 2023)" and have been working to resolve issues surrounding rare diseases.
On the other hand, it was brought to light once again that many issues for patients and families affected by rare diseases have yet to be resolved, and it was necessary to take up the voices of healthcare professionals who support rare disease medicine in Japan and accelerate more concrete efforts to address them.

This document summarizes the direction of problem solving in rare disease medicine and the actions required by each stakeholder in response to the issues identified in this survey. The Pharmaceutical Manufacturers Association of Japan (PMAJ) is committed to working together with various stakeholders to resolve issues surrounding rare diseases so that many people are aware of the challenges they face and to realize a society in which patients and families living with rare diseases can live with peace of mind.
